Job Role
The accounting expert will strengthen the Accounting Team of our customer and will ensure and set up efficient and compliant workflows to guarantee high quality for the transactions an processes within Accounting. Will perform analysis and reporting for internal and external audiences (Accounting management, Group Accounting, statutory auditors etc.)
What you will do
- GL Accounting activities for assigned entity in accordance with IFRS and local GAAP;
- Analysis and booking of Provisions, Accruals and Deferrals on the assigned entities;
- Participation at the preparation of monthly/quarterly and year end closing (IFRS/HGB) in accordance with the reporting calendars;
- Close cooperation with the accounting colleagues from branches, subsidiaries and central accounting teams;
- Check of travel expenses and their specific documentation;
- Accounts reconciliations (e.g. bank, assets, provisions, deferrals);
- Perform analysis of Financial Statements to ensure compliance and integrity of financial reporting;
- Customer focus, keep customers informed and provide applicable information;
- Continuous enhancement of data quality on a global level by developing and analyzing meaningful KPI’S;
- Ad hoc project work (e.g. branch carve out, SAP testing, etc) including analysis of deliverables as well as meeting deadlines / milestones and appropriate information and communication for the management;
- Active contribution in improving and implementing global operation processes and workflows as well as the development of global policies and procedures regarding the areas of accounting in IFRS, HGB and Solvency 2.
What you bring
- Good knowledge of IFRS and regulatory reporting (Knowledge in other GAAP is a plus);
- Good experience with SAP FI accounting systems;
- University degree in economics, finance or related field;
- Fluent in English, good communication skills (French or another European Language is a plus)
- ACCA, CECCAR or similar diplomas are a plus.
- More than 3 years of experience in General Ledger accounting
